LUCANIA. Metapontion. Circa 340-330 BC. Didrachm or Nomos (Silver, 20 mm, 7.78 g, 11 h). Bearded head of Leukippos to right, wearing Corinthian helmet; behind, cross-torch. Rev. META Barley ear with leaf to right; above leaf, |-H. HN Italy 1555. Johnston Class A, 5.8. SNG ANS 405. Darkly toned. The obverse struck from a somewhat worn die with minor die breaks, otherwise, very fine.


From an old Swiss collection, formed in the 1970s and privately purchased from Numismatica Arethusa (with original ticket).
